fix: add periodic flush and graceful shutdown for server-side telemetry

The TelemetryClient only flushed at 50 events, so the server silently
lost all queued telemetry on restart. Add startPeriodicFlush/stop methods
to TelemetryClient, wire up 60s periodic flush in server initTelemetry,
and flush on SIGTERM/SIGINT before exit.

startPeriodicFlush(intervalMs: number = 60_000): void {
if (this.flushInterval) return;
this.flushInterval = setInterval(() => {
void this.flush();
}, intervalMs);
// Allow the process to exit even if the interval is still active
if (typeof this.flushInterval === "object" && "unref" in this.flushInterval) {
this.flushInterval.unref();
}
}
stop(): void {
if (this.flushInterval) {
clearInterval(this.flushInterval);
this.flushInterval = null;
}
}
